Output 681b8b73a3a03fc385d54d9ce072a256f61e4f4a390b0e4394e9d5ce5ed6bc67:3

value
21937172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c4133fc72f61eac1ad95c83e93c7d34cb7b6fb OP_EQUAL
address
3HzF6ETC5aPiAw2rN5cHFgBK23PdUxMHue
transaction
681b8b73a3a03fc385d54d9ce072a256f61e4f4a390b0e4394e9d5ce5ed6bc67
spent
true